The Climate Challenge is run by a group of young leaders aged 15-20 from across the country who are passionate about empowering our peers to take action on climate change. We were founded by a group of high school students in 2015 with the support of Generation Zero and have since grown into a national organisation. The Climate Challenge is nonpartisan, recognising that climate progress needs the support of all political parties not just a few. We work hard to help young people connect with political leaders from across parliament to both make their own informed political opinions and be heard by New Zealand’s leaders.
